Druck auf Anfrage Neuware - Printed after ordering - This text introduces graduate students and researchers to the basics of digital signal processing relevant to audio/acoustics and psychoacoustics and a variety of topics and latest results in immersive audio processing research.Kay features: Covers relevant background material adequatelyTopics include immersive audio synthesis and rendering, multichannel room equalization, audio selective signal cancellation, signal processing for audio applications, surround sound processing, psychoacoustics and its incorporation in audio signal processing algorithms for solving various problemsReal-world measurements depicted in the book demonstrate efficiency and power of the various solutions presentedThis timely graduate textbook targets courses on Immersive Audio Signal Processing, DSP and Multimedia Processing, and is an invaluable reference for researchers interested in understanding the synergy between acoustics/audio signal processing and psychoacoustics, and how these are melded to solve various hot topics in immersive multichannel audio processing.

Taschenbuch. Condition: Neu. This item is printed on demand - Print on Demand Titel. Neuware -This is one of the first graduate texts on Immersive Audio Signal Processing. It provides an introduction to Digital Signal Processing and Psychoacoustics, as well as a wealth of state-of-the-art applications in Audio Signal Processing, a popular and timely aspect of all Signal Processing courses within Electrical Engineering curricula. The text lays out the foundation of DSP for audio and the fundamentals of auditory perception, then goes on to discuss immersive audio rendering and synthesis, the digital equalization of room acoustics, and various DSP implementations.
